WOBM-FM (92.7 FM) is an adult contemporary music formatted radio station known as "Ocean County's Hometown Station" broadcasting in Central New Jersey. Its variety of music stretches from artists such as Celine Dion to Billy Joel and Faith Hill. The station is owned by Townsquare Media, and is part of the Shore Group with five stations including WOBM, WJLK, WCHR-FM and WADB. Shore Group studios are at 8 Robbins Street in Toms River, New Jersey. WOBM's FM transmitter is in Bayville, New Jersey. "Ocean County's Soft Rock" officially changed formats to "Ocean County's Best Variety" in January of 2015. Source
